Frequently asked

About Madison Elementary
How many students attend Madison Elementary?
Madison Elementary enrolls approximately 375 students in grades KG-05.
What grades does Madison Elementary serve?
Madison Elementary serves grades KG-05.
What is the student-teacher ratio at Madison Elementary?
The student-to-teacher ratio at Madison Elementary is approximately 25.0:1 (15 FTE teachers).
What is the racial breakdown of students at Madison Elementary?
At Madison Elementary, the student body is approximately 10% White, 46% Hispanic, 18% Black, 16% Asian, 9% Two or more.
Is Madison Elementary public or private?
Madison Elementary is a public K-12 school, overseen by Long Beach Unified.
